A randomized, double-blind study of 30 versus 20 mg dexmethylphenidate extended-release in children with attention-deficit/hyperactivity disorder: late-day symptom control.

ABSTRACT
The objective of this study was to evaluate the safety and efficacy of dexmethylphenidate extended-release (d-MPH-ER) 30 versus 20 mg in children with attention-deficit/hyperactivity disorder (ADHD) in a 12-hour laboratory classroom setting. In a randomized, double-blind, 3-period × 3-treatment, crossover study, children aged 6 to 12 years with Diagnostic and Statistical Manual of Mental Disorders, Fourth Edition-diagnosed ADHD previously stabilized on MPH (40-60 mg/d) or D-MPH (20-30 mg/day) [corrected] were randomized to receive D-MPH-ER 20 mg/day, 30 mg/day, [corrected] or placebo for 7 days each. Primary efficacy measurements were change in the average SKAMP-Combined [corrected] score from predose to 10, 11, and 12 hours postdose [Avg(10-12)] between 30 mg [corrected] and 20 mg D-MPH-ER. Safety was assessed by adverse events, (AEs), [corrected] vital sign monitoring, and ECGs. [corrected] A total of 165 children were randomized, and 162 included in the intent-to-treat analysis. Mean Avg (10-12) change from pre-dose [corrected] in SKAMP-Combined score was significantly greater for D-MPH-ER 30 mg (-4.47) compared with D-MPH-ER 20 mg (-2.02; P = 0.002). Most common adverse events (≥ 3% in any group) were decreased appetite (6.1%, 4.9%, and 0%), headache (4.3%, 4.3%, and 1.9%), abdominal pain (3.7%, 3.1%, and 3.1%), and tachycardia (1.2%, 3.1%, and 0.6%) for D-MPH-ER 30 mg, D-MPH-ER 20 mg, and placebo, respectively). Significantly greater improvement in ADHD symptoms was noted with D-MPH-ER 30 mg compared with D-MPH-ER 20 mg at hours 10 through 12. Tolerability was comparable between doses. Dexmethylphenidate extended-release 30-mg dose may provide further benefit to patients who do not maintain optimal symptom control later in the day with D-MPH-ER 20 mg.
